Supplies Used:

Directions:

Get creative!

We used the wire cutters to cut our garland to length, covering the bottom half of the ring.

We then wrapped the trees around the garland.

Then we added different accessories to each ring until we liked what we ended with.

Cut ribbon to length (about 18″ each).

Fold ribbon in half to make a U shape. Lay it under the ring then pull the ribbon strings on top of the strings toward you to.

Display on your front door or around your home, wherever you need to add a little holiday cheer!
